11 分で読了
4 views

自動音楽譜面起こしにおける機械学習技術の体系的調査

(MACHINE LEARNING TECHNIQUES IN AUTOMATIC MUSIC TRANSCRIPTION: A SYSTEMATIC SURVEY)

さらに深い洞察を得る

AI戦略の専門知識を身につけ、競争優位性を構築しませんか?

AIBR プレミアム
年間たったの9,800円で
“AIに詳しい人”として
一目置かれる存在に!

プレミア会員になって、山ほどあるAI論文の中から効率よく大事な情報を手に入れ、まわりと圧倒的な差をつけませんか?

詳細を見る
【実践型】
生成AI活用キャンプ
【文部科学省認可】
満足度100%の生成AI講座
3ヶ月後には、
あなたも生成AIマスター!

「学ぶ」だけではなく「使える」ように。
経営者からも圧倒的な人気を誇るBBT大学の講座では、3ヶ月間質問し放題!誰1人置いていかずに寄り添います。

詳細を見る

田中専務

拓海先生、最近部下から『自動音楽譜面起こし(Automatic Music Transcription、AMT)って将来性ありますか』と聞かれて困っています。要するにうちの会社の業務に使えるかどうかだけを知りたいのですが、何ができて何がまだ課題なのか端的に教えていただけますか。

AIメンター拓海

素晴らしい着眼点ですね!大丈夫、一緒に整理していきますよ。結論を先に言うと、自動音楽譜面起こし(AMT)は特定用途では実用的に使える段階ですが、楽器の重なりや演奏表現の細かな解釈では人間の専門家に及ばない局面が多いです。まず基礎を押さえ、その後で導入の勘所を3点にまとめて説明できるようにしますね。

田中専務

基礎からでお願いします。現場の社員に説明するときに専門用語を出されると引かれるので、なるべく実務での利点と限界を教えてください。

AIメンター拓海

了解しました。まず一歩目は、AMTとは『音声データを楽譜や音符などの記号に変換する技術』だと理解してください。次に、技術構成は大きく分けて、音の解析(周波数解析)と音符の推定(何の音がいつ鳴ったか)に分かれます。最後に導入の判断は『目的の明確化』『音源の性質』『評価方法』の三つを見ると分かりやすいですよ。

田中専務

これって要するに、録音をそのまま機械にやらせて楽譜にするのは可能だけど、複雑なバンド演奏や重なりの多い曲では誤りが出やすい、ということですか。

AIメンター拓海

その通りです!素晴らしい着眼点ですね。具体的には三つ問題があります。第一に、ポリフォニー(polyphony、多声音)と呼ばれる音の重なりで分離が難しい点。第二に、楽器ごとの音色(ティンバー、timbre)認識が難しい点。第三に、演奏表現(強弱やテンポ変化)の符号化が難しい点です。でも、用途を限定すれば非常に有用に使えるんです。

田中専務

用途を限定する、とは具体的にどんな場面ですか。例えばうちのような楽器を作る会社なら試作品の音取りとか、楽譜にしやすいと思うのですが。

AIメンター拓海

いいですね、その発想は正解です。たとえば単一楽器の試奏データ、ピアノソロ、メロディ抽出のみを目的にするなど、音が混ざりにくい状況では精度が大きく上がります。経営判断なら、まずは『狭いスコープでPoC(Proof of Concept、概念実証)を回す』ことを推奨します。大丈夫、一緒にやれば必ずできますよ。

田中専務

導入のコスト面が気になります。効果が薄ければ部下に叱られます。どのように費用対効果を測ればよいですか。

AIメンター拓海

良い質問です。投資対効果の評価は三点で行います。第一に、現状の工数(人手で楽譜化する時間)を把握する。第二に、AMTを導入した場合の精度とそれに伴う手直し時間を見積もる。第三に、導入・運用コスト(クラウド費用やエンジニアの工数)を比較する。これで比較的現実的な数字が出ますよ。

田中専務

なるほど。最後に、今の研究で特に注目すべき点を3つにまとめてもらえますか。会議で短く言えるように。

AIメンター拓海

もちろんです。短く3点でまとめます。1) 専門領域では既に実用水準の成果があること。2) 多声音や楽器認識などの課題は残るが、用途を限定すれば解決可能であること。3) PoCで効果測定を行い、段階的に投資することが最も効率的であること。これで十分に議論を始められますよ。

田中専務

ありがとうございます。要点が明確になりました。では、私の言葉で整理してみます。自動音楽譜面起こしは『単独の楽器や単純な音源では実用的で、複雑な合奏ではまだ人の助けが必要だが、まずは狭い範囲で試して効果を見てから投資を拡大する』ということですね。

AIメンター拓海

その通りです!素晴らしいまとめですね。これで会議でも迷わず説明できるはずです。何か実証に向けて手伝えることがあれば、いつでもご相談ください。大丈夫、一緒にやれば必ずできますよ。


1.概要と位置づけ

結論を先に述べる。本調査は自動音楽譜面起こし(Automatic Music Transcription、AMT)が持つ技術的可能性と限界を体系的に整理したものであり、最も大きな変化は『機械学習、特に深層学習の適用により、特定条件下での実用性が飛躍的に高まった』点である。これにより、単一楽器やソロ演奏、メロディ抽出などの用途では手作業の削減が期待できる。

なぜ重要かを示す。音楽情報検索(Music Information Retrieval、MIR)は楽曲の分析や制作支援に直結する分野であり、譜面化はその基盤となる情報へ変換する役割を果たす。企業にとっては試作品の品質管理、コンテンツの資産化、教育用途の効率化といった応用が見込める。

本調査は既存研究をジャンル別に整理し、伝統的な信号処理手法から確率モデル、非負値行列因子分解(Non-negative Matrix Factorization、NMF)、そしてニューラルネットワークまでを比較検討している。各手法の得失を明確にすることで、導入判断の材料を提供する。特に深層学習は高精度だがデータ依存性が高いという特徴が確認される。

業務応用の観点からは、まず『目的の明確化』が不可欠である。すなわち、全自動で完璧な譜面を期待するのか、半自動で作業を補助するレベルでよいのかを定義することで、適切な手法選定と評価指標が決まる。コストや工数の削減幅はここで大きく変わる。

最後に位置づけとして、AMTは『万能ツール』ではなく『条件依存で有用な技術』である。したがって経営判断としては段階的な投資、限定的スコープでのPoC推進、運用後の継続的な評価と改善を基本戦略とするべきである。

2.先行研究との差別化ポイント

本調査が差別化する点は、手法を技術的ディメンションで細かく分類し、それぞれの適用可能領域を明示した点である。従来の概説は手法の列挙に終始することが多かったが、本稿は『どの条件でどの手法が現実的か』を重視している。経営判断に必要な実務的示唆を与える構成である。

また、深層学習モデルの登場による精度向上を具体的なケースで示しつつ、データ準備やラベル付けのコストという現場の負担も率直に評価している点が特徴である。つまり高精度は得られるが、それには学習用の適切なデータセットが必要だと結論づけている。

従来手法としての非負値行列因子分解(NMF)は計算量が小さく現場導入に向く一方で、表現力に限界があることを示している。確率モデルやベイジアン手法は解釈性に優れるが、スケール面で不利である。このようにトレードオフを明確化している。

本稿はまた、最近のTransformerベースのアプローチやスペクトログラム再構成を扱う研究を取り上げ、モデルアーキテクチャの進化がもたらす実務的インパクトを論じている。特に楽器分離やオンセット(onset)検出の改善が応用範囲を広げる点を示している。

総じて、差別化ポイントは『実務適用を念頭に置いた評価軸の提示』であり、これにより経営層が検討する際の判断材料が整備されている点である。

3.中核となる技術的要素

主要な技術要素は二つの層で理解するのが分かりやすい。第一層は信号処理の領域で、時間周波数解析やスペクトログラム生成といった前処理がここに含まれる。第二層は推論の領域で、ピッチ推定やオンセット検出、楽器分類といったタスクを機械学習モデルが担う。

専門用語の初出について整理する。Fundamental Frequency(f0、基本周波数)は音の高さの核心情報であり、Multi-f0(多重基本周波数)推定は同時に複数音が存在する場合の識別を意味する。これらの精度がAMT全体の精度を大きく左右する。

非負値行列因子分解(NMF)はスペクトログラムを成分に分解する手法で、シンプルかつ高速だが複雑な音色変化には弱い。対照的に深層ニューラルネットワーク(Deep Neural Networks、DNN)は大量データから複雑なパターンを学習できるが、計算資源とデータが必要である。

最近の進展としては、オンセットとフレーム(Onsets and Frames)を同時に最適化するデュアルオブジェクティブや、Transformerを利用した文脈把握の強化がある。これにより特定ケースでの誤検出が減り、実用上の信頼性が向上している。

実務的示唆として、前処理の質とタスク分割(ピッチ推定と楽器分離の分担)が導入成否を決める。結果として、技術選定は目的と運用体制に応じて最適化されるべきである。

4.有効性の検証方法と成果

検証方法は標準的評価指標と現場評価の二軸で行うべきである。標準的指標としては精度(accuracy)やF値(F-measure)などが用いられるが、これらは実務上の手直し時間や誤りの許容度を直接反映しない。したがってユーザー評価を組み合わせることが重要である。

論文群では単一楽器やソロ演奏に対して高いスコアが報告されているが、ポリフォニック(多声音)データでは依然として差が大きい。特に楽器が重なり、スペクトルが混ざるケースでの誤認識が目立つ。

また学習済みモデルの一般化能力に関する検討も多く、楽器や録音環境が異なる現場では性能が急低下する報告もある。これはデータの多様性確保がいかに重要かを示している。つまり現場導入では実データでの再評価が必須である。

一方で、特定用途に限定した場合の成果は実務的に有用であり、例えば楽器点検や教育用途、メロディ抽出といったタスクでは手戻りが少ないという報告がある。これがPoCを勧める根拠になる。

結論として、有効性は『用途の明確化』と『評価設計』に依存する。精度指標だけで判断せず、実際の作業負荷削減にどれだけ寄与するかを評価基準にするべきである。

5.研究を巡る議論と課題

現在の主要な議論点は三つある。第一はデータ依存性であり、高性能モデルは大量かつ多様なラベル付きデータを必要とする。第二は多声音の分離問題であり、これは音源分離(source separation)研究と密接に関連している。第三は表現性の解釈であり、強弱や装飾音といった音楽的表現をどう扱うかが未解決である。

これらの課題は技術的に解決可能な面と、音楽的解釈の問題として解決困難な面が混在している。すなわち、信号的に分離可能でも、音楽的には『誰がどのような意図で演奏したか』という解釈が要求される場面がある。

実務的には、ラベル付けコストの低減とドメイン固有データの整備が優先課題になる。これには社内でのデータ収集計画や外部との協業が重要で、経営判断としての資源配分が鍵となる。投資は段階的に行うべきだ。

また評価基準の標準化も議論されている。研究コミュニティ内では多様なデータセットと評価方法が使われており、これが結果の比較を難しくしている。企業は自社の業務目標に合わせた独自評価を設計する必要がある。

総括すると、技術的進展は著しいが適用には注意が必要であり、経営的には限定的導入から始め、現場での効果を計測しつつ段階的に拡大する方針が合理的である。

6.今後の調査・学習の方向性

今後の研究や企業での学習は三点を軸に進めるべきだ。第一にデータ基盤の整備である。多様な演奏・録音環境のデータを収集し、ラベル付けの効率化を図ることが必須である。第二にタスク分割とハイブリッド手法の開発であり、信号処理と学習モデルを組み合わせることで現場対応力を高める。

第三に評価の業務適合性の追求である。学術的指標と業務上の手戻り削減効果を結び付ける評価設計が必要だ。実際の導入ではPoCフェーズでこれらを検証し、クリティカルパスを見極めてから本格導入に踏み切るべきである。

また、外部ベンダーや研究機関との連携も有効であり、社内リソースだけで全てを賄うのではなく、協業により開発コストと時間を削減することが現実的である。これにより現場適用のスピードを上げられる。

最終的に、経営判断としては『小さく始めて測定し、拡大する』が最善である。AMTは技術的な成熟段階にあり、用途に応じた設計と評価を行えば業務上の有効性を十分に引き出せる。

検索に使える英語キーワード:Automatic Music Transcription, AMT, Music Information Retrieval, MIR, Non-negative Matrix Factorization, NMF, Deep Neural Networks, Transformers, Onset Detection, Pitch Estimation


会議で使えるフレーズ集

「目的を限定してPoCを先行し、実データでの精度と手直し工数を評価しましょう。」

「単一楽器やメロディ抽出では既に実用水準に達しているため、まずそこから始めるのが現実的です。」

「高精度モデルはデータが必要です。社内データ収集とラベル付けの計画を並行して進めます。」


F. Jamshidi et al., “MACHINE LEARNING TECHNIQUES IN AUTOMATIC MUSIC TRANSCRIPTION: A SYSTEMATIC SURVEY,” arXiv preprint arXiv:2406.15249v1, 2024.

監修者

阪上雅昭(SAKAGAMI Masa-aki)
京都大学 人間・環境学研究科 名誉教授

論文研究シリーズ
前の記事
知識駆動サブスペース融合と勾配調整によるマルチモーダル学習
(Knowledge-driven Subspace Fusion and Gradient Coordination for Multi-modal Learning)
次の記事
対話型LLMベースのプログラム修復フレームワーク
(Cref: An LLM-based Conversational Software Repair Framework for Programming Tutors)
関連記事
時間系列における不可逆性の関数分解と推定
(Functional Decomposition and Estimation of Irreversibility in Time Series via Machine Learning)
InfiAlign:大規模言語モデルの推論力を効率的に高めるスケーラブルな整合フレームワーク
(InfiAlign: A Scalable and Sample-Efficient Framework for Aligning LLMs to Enhance Reasoning Capabilities)
フィードバック制御による逐次ラッソ・スクリーニング
(Feedback-Controlled Sequential Lasso Screening)
∆Σ IADCを再帰的オートエンコーダとして設計するRCNet
(RCNet: ∆Σ IADCs as Recurrent AutoEncoders)
敵対者嗜好整合による拡散ベースの非制限的敵対的攻撃の強化
(Enhancing Diffusion-based Unrestricted Adversarial Attacks via Adversary Preferences Alignment)
CCP支援UMAPおよびt-SNEによるscRNA-seqデータ解析
(Analyzing scRNA-seq data by CCP-assisted UMAP and t-SNE)
関連タグ
この記事をシェア

有益な情報を同僚や仲間と共有しませんか?

AI技術革新 - 人気記事
ブラックホールと量子機械学習の対応
(Black hole/quantum machine learning correspondence)
生成AI検索における敏感なユーザークエリの分類と分析
(Taxonomy and Analysis of Sensitive User Queries in Generative AI Search System)
DiReDi:AIoTアプリケーションのための蒸留と逆蒸留
(DiReDi: Distillation and Reverse Distillation for AIoT Applications)

PCも苦手だった私が

“AIに詳しい人“
として一目置かれる存在に!
  • AIBRプレミアム
  • 実践型生成AI活用キャンプ
あなたにオススメのカテゴリ
論文研究
さらに深い洞察を得る

AI戦略の専門知識を身につけ、競争優位性を構築しませんか?

AIBR プレミアム
年間たったの9,800円で
“AIに詳しい人”として一目置かれる存在に!

プレミア会員になって、山ほどあるAI論文の中から効率よく大事な情報を手に入れ、まわりと圧倒的な差をつけませんか?

詳細を見る
【実践型】
生成AI活用キャンプ
【文部科学省認可】
満足度100%の生成AI講座
3ヶ月後には、あなたも生成AIマスター!

「学ぶ」だけではなく「使える」ように。
経営者からも圧倒的な人気を誇るBBT大学の講座では、3ヶ月間質問し放題!誰1人置いていかずに寄り添います。

詳細を見る

AI Benchmark Researchをもっと見る

今すぐ購読し、続きを読んで、すべてのアーカイブにアクセスしましょう。

続きを読む